Landscape with Hercules and Omphale, Matthijs Pool, After Barend Graat, 1696 - 1727 print The effeminate Hercules and Queen Omphale, with the attributes of Hercules, caress each other. Pan - who is in love with the queen - is stretched out on the ground. He has just been kicked away by Hercules. Omphales servants are rushed in the background. Amsterdam paper etching / engraving Hercules, in female garment, kicks Pan from Omphale's bed
